What Makes a CCTV Camera Truly Weatherproof?

Weatherproof cameras require an IP66 or higher rating, indicating resistance to dust and heavy rain. Look for operating temperature ranges (-40°C to 60°C) and corrosion-resistant materials like aluminum alloy. Advanced models feature heated housings to prevent ice buildup and hydrophobic lens coatings. For coastal areas, prioritize cameras with IK10 vandal-proof ratings and anti-fog technology.

IP Rating Protection Level Recommended Use
IP65 Dust-tight, water jets Urban areas with moderate rain
IP66 Strong water jets Coastal regions
IP67 Immersion up to 1m Flood-prone zones

Manufacturers often test weatherproof cameras using MIL-STD-810G standards, simulating hail impacts and salt spray corrosion. For Arctic environments, models with self-regulating heating elements maintain optimal performance at -50°C, while desert variants incorporate UV-resistant polymers to prevent casing degradation. Always verify third-party certifications like ANSI/UL 2044 for fire resistance and ATEX ratings for explosive atmospheres.

How Does Temperature Extremity Affect Camera Performance?

Extreme cold (-40°C) can drain batteries 3x faster in wireless models. Heat above 50°C risks sensor overheating, causing image distortion. Thermal-regulated cameras auto-adjust internal heating/cooling. Pro tip: Install sunshades in desert climates and use silicone sealant on cable connections. Industrial-grade models with stainless steel mounts perform best in fluctuating temperatures.

Can Wireless Weatherproof Cameras Match Wired Reliability?

Modern wireless cameras (5GHz frequency) offer 99.5% signal stability with mesh network compatibility. Battery life ranges from 6 months (Reolink Argus) to 2 years (Arlo Pro 4). Key advantages include easier installation and failover to cellular backup. However, wired PoE systems remain superior for 24/7 recording, with latency under 0.3 seconds versus wireless’s 1-2 second delay.

Feature Wireless Wired
Installation Time 15 minutes 2-4 hours
Data Security WPA3 encryption Physical cable protection
Max Resolution 4K 8K

Hybrid systems combining wireless flexibility with wired reliability are gaining popularity. Solar-powered options like Reolink Argus Eco eliminate battery concerns, while dual-band routers minimize interference. For construction sites, wireless cameras with LTE backup ensure uninterrupted monitoring despite temporary power outages.

What Are Hidden Costs When Ordering Security Cameras Online?

Watch for:
Subscription fees ($3-$50/month for cloud storage)
– Additional sensors (door/window)
– Professional installation charges ($80-$200)
– Replacement batteries ($40-$90)
– Lightning arrestors for wired systems
– GDPR compliance fees in EU countries
Tip: Bundled systems often provide 15-20% cost savings versus individual components.
